For Santander, each year the company repossesses about 14 percent of cars with outstanding loans, according to an analysis of publicly available annual reports filed from 2011 to 2020. Credit Acceptance has an even higher repossession rateroughly 35 percentaccording to statements made by Busk, the companys senior vice president and treasurer at the time, to stock market analysts in 2015. The lawsuit covers the period from November 2015 to April 2021, when an estimated 1.9 million consumers with a median 546 FICO credit score and $35,000 annual gross income borrowed from Credit Acceptance. And the states complaint cites internal company communication in which an unnamed Santander vice president told staff that the company makes money even when customers default, and another employee said a loan made sense even if the customer was only expected to make one years worth of payments. Moreover, even when Santander and Credit Acceptance have a borrower who defaults, they still manage to make a profit, the state attorneys general in Mississippi and Massachusetts have alleged in lawsuits filed against the lenders, using a variety of tools to squeeze as much money out of delinquent borrowers as possible, as one put it. Those methods, according to a Consumer Reports review of regulatory filing and legal documents, sometimes start with lenders working with dealers to mark up cars sold to low-income borrowers more than they do for customers with better credit, or to upsell them into pricier cars they cant afford. But the CFPBs analysis suggests that the higher rate of default among borrowers with low credit might not be because they pose a higher risk but because theyre charged higher interest rates, about 15 percent, on average, by auto finance companies compared with about 10 percent for those securing financing from a bank. In fact, even including when borrowers default, Healey says that the company stood to gain over $3,100 in profit on the average loan it made to Massachusetts borrowers between 2013 and 2019.
